Last night, NC State QB Russell Wilson took a horrendous shot to the head from a South Carolina defender. He crumpled to the ground, did not move, and thus began one of those queasy, interminable, and horrible moments where both teams kneel, pray, and just hope one of their own hasn't lost the ability to walk.
↵
↵ The crowd fell silent, and after a tense stretch of minutes the medical staff put Wilson on a backboard, loaded him on the injury cart, and took him to the locker room. As he left, Wilson gave the thumbs up sign to show he was OK. ↵
